Job Description:

We are looking for experienced professionals capable of designing and developing complex software systems from scratch, defining project-wide technical solutions, and establishing as well as maintaining best engineering practices.

Job Responsibility:

  • Designing and developing complex software systems from scratch
  • Defining project-wide technical solutions
  • Establishing and maintaining best engineering practices

Requirements:

  • 5+ years of professional experience in IT
  • Strong background in Microsoft .NET and solid knowledge of ASP.NET MVC and Web API
  • Experience working with databases (SQL or NoSQL) and ORM frameworks
  • Hands-on experience with Azure services (Functions, Logic Apps, Service Bus, Cosmos DB, Azure Monitor / Application Insights, etc.)
  • Solid understanding and practical application of software design patterns and best practices
  • English proficiency at B1+ level

Nice to have:

  • Experience in frontend development (HTML5, JavaScript / TypeScript, React, etc.)
  • Experience setting up and maintaining development processes (CI/CD, code reviews, static code analysis, automated testing)
  • Experience working with SCRUM or other Agile methodologies
  • Experience creating technical documentation
  • Experience with system integrations
What we offer:
  • Projects for such clients as PayPal, Wargaming, Xerox, Philips, Adidas and Toyota
  • Competitive compensation that depends on your qualification and skills
  • Career development system with clear skill qualifications
  • Flexible working hours aligned to your schedule
  • Options to work remotely
  • Corporate medical insurance covering services of private and public medical centers
  • English courses online
  • Corporate parties and events for employees and their children
  • Internal conferences, workshops and meetups for learning and experience sharing
  • Gym membership compensation
  • 5 days of paid sick leave per year with no obligation to submit a sick-leave certificate
